Output 695bec2bf0634ffe57f6e83b933d5bccd8edbd44dcb0a2ed0185ea53faaa1ec7:1

value
72188501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c5218a86f821ff5a20f217856f733e0ed8023b OP_EQUAL
address
3M63L7dmjNHZfkCwzALdzMGxa8GxLbmXpK
transaction
695bec2bf0634ffe57f6e83b933d5bccd8edbd44dcb0a2ed0185ea53faaa1ec7
spent
true